WebAug 31, 2024 · 6 Meteor Crater, Arizona. Route 66 is home to many things and perhaps one of the more unusual is the world’s largest preserved meteor crater. A stop in Flagstaff, Arizona will allow access to this mammoth crater measuring 2.4 miles across and a crazy 550 feet in depth. RELATED: 10 Step Itinerary For Every Seinfeld Fan Visiting New York.
